兔自体神经原位移植限制创伤性神经瘤形成机理

摘    要:本实验采用家兔近端正中神经和尺神经原位移植法研究预防创伤性神经瘤形成之机理。经光镜,透射电镜及免疫组化标记观察表明:(1)自体神经原位移植法能有效地抑制创伤性神经瘤形成。两神经再生的神经纤维在移植段中排列整齐,来自两神经的轴索末端髓鞘对接是抑制创伤性神经瘤形成的关键;(2)移植段中由于雪旺氏细胞增生所形成的雪旺氏鞘对近端神经轴索的再生有趋化和引导作用;(3)单纯吻合法不能抑制创伤性神经瘤的发生。

Experimental Study of the Mechanism of Autogenous Nerve Replantation in situ Inhibition of Traumatic Neuroma Formation

Abstract:In this study, two experimental patterns of autogenous nerve replantation in situ and centrocentral nerve simple suture were performed on the rabbit median and ulnar nerves. By light and transmission electron microscopy and immunohistochemistry, the results showed that autogenous nerve replantation in situ could inhibit neuroma formation, and its mechanism might that two proximal stump axons could conjunct within interpolated graft segment, and the nerve simple suture could not inhibit neuroma development for lack of proper environment for conjunction of two proximal stump axons.
